Common profile gaps

Where plumbing profiles often lose clarity.

A plumbing profile does not need to say everything. It needs to make the most important details easy to find. Here are frequent gaps we review.

Core plumbing services are hard to scan

Repair, installation, drain, water heater, fixture, and other services may be missing, outdated, or difficult for customers to understand at a glance.

Urgent-service details are unclear

Customers may not be able to quickly tell the right way to contact your business when they have a time-sensitive plumbing issue.

Location information does not match

Service-area details can feel inconsistent when the profile and website describe where you work differently.

The profile lacks recent proof of care

Old photos, unanswered reviews, and incomplete business information can make an otherwise solid company feel less current.
